**Runbook: Account recovery for the Pinglass pinning service**

If the service account enforcing our dependency pinning policy becomes inaccessible, do not create a new account; doing so orphans the signed lockfile history. Instead, follow the recovery path: verify you are on the Harrowfen VPN, open the recovery console, and select the pinning-bot account. The console will prompt for two things: the account name exactly as registered, and the recovery passphrase recorded directly below this paragraph.

strongbox words: briiel-zoreth-noveth-pelys-druwyn-feniel-lamvan-ulaius-kasion

## ScanBridge Intake — Runbook

The Vexmark barcode scanners post decoded payloads to the ScanBridge intake service over TLS. Each scanner station authenticates with a shared station token, rotated quarterly by the Delvane ops team. Payloads are validated against the SKU registry before queueing. For review purposes, the current intake credential is as follows.

API key for fahip-kahip: zpat23_XiJGUHz5xfaAtaIqUkus0rh

Step 4 — cutover. The Ormskirk refactor replaces the legacy Drossel ORM with the new mapper in `persistence/v2`. Run the schema diff, confirm zero drift, and flip `USE_V2_MAPPER=true`. Old connection pooling is gone; the new layer authenticates to the Halvane database proxy per-request instead of via the shared pool user. That means the proxy credential is now mandatory in the env file, not optional. Reviewers: reject any PR that hardcodes it. Set the proxy credential on the next line.

env line for fahag-fafop: LEDGER_TOKEN3=815

Memo to the Board — Hartleaf Goods

Quick update: the new Evergreen subscription tier is ready to go. It bundles free shipping, early product drops, and the loyalty perks folks kept asking for. Soft launch ran smoothly in the Dunmore market, and uptake beat our modest targets. Full rollout is slated for next month, pending your nod. One item below stays strictly within this group.

board note of fafog-yahap: Project Rusdor slips by a full year because of the audit delay.